The opportunity available is for a Human Resources Generalist located at our Tukwila, Washington office. You will need experience with HR functional knowledge to perform in the following HR areas: recruitment, employee relations, training, process improvement and compliance. Additional duties include but are not limited to:

Recruitment

· Develop and manage assigned job vacancies in partnership with technician recruiter and hiring managers that meet hiring target dates with competitive candidates. Ensure positive candidate experiences at every stage of the recruitment process. Utilize Ultipro ATS.

· Partner with hiring managers on all aspects of employment including creating, posting and managing the recruitment process through a successful and memorable onboarding of new hires.

Employee Relations:

· Advise and counsel Supervisors and Managers regarding employee concerns by suggesting proactive solutions that help to build a positive workplace culture.

· Coach and provide consultation to leadership on all aspects of employment which includes employee coaching, counseling and separations.

· Facilitate employee relations counseling, including conducting investigations and recommending appropriate corrective action and drafting disciplinary action documents, in accordance with established progressive disciplinary guidelines.

· Promote positive working relationships within organizations.

Professional Services and Compliance

· Facilitate and manage key professional services duties, including the performance management review process, managing FMLA, worker’s compensation, onboarding and personnel documents.

· Coordinate timely processing of performance reviews and compensation adjustments.

· Maintain HR metrics for assigned customer groups and for HR reporting.

· Responsible for guiding all employees to ensure consistent adherence to the Harnish Group, Inc. corporate strategy and company policies, procedures, and practices.

· Facilitate employee, manager meetings and training on HR related programs and policies to include our annual Employee Opinion Survey, Open Enrollment and other employee related projects.

· Maintain EEO/AAP data; oversee annual reporting requirements.

· Assist the safety team with investigations pertaining to workplace injuries.

· Coordinate workers compensation light duty and return to work with employees and supervisors.

Personal Attributes, Experience, and Education:

· Minimum of 5-7 years of HR experience gained through positions primarily serving operational, non-exempt and management employees. Bachelor’s degree preferred in Human Resources, Business Administration or equivalent in work experience.

· Experience in recruitment, compliance, employee relations and benefits.

· Communicate effectively with HR team members and all levels of the organization in a variety of workplace situations with professionalism, a strong customer focus, confidentiality and diplomacy.

· Commitment to protect confidential and sensitive employee and business information is essential.

· Strong verbal and written communications skills to respond to, and present HR related items.

· Manage multiple tasks and projects with unexpected requests and changing priorities.

· Strong knowledge of Microsoft Office products including Excel.

· Flexibility to visit assigned branches in the Western Washington areas.

Harnish Group Inc. is the Caterpillar Dealer in Central and Western Washington, Central and Eastern Montana, Northwestern Wyoming, Northwestern North Dakota and the state of Alaska. Our Member Companies, representing Caterpillar, are N C Machinery, N C The Cat Rental Store, N C Power Systems, Tractor & Equipment Co., T & E the Cat Rental Store, and SITECH.
